The best way for a self learning is open as many other anme files other forum members share here. There are lots of them.
Play with them, look how they are done... try to do the same...
Also a good advice is read the forum from back to front. I mean read the latest post first and you'll find a gold mine there. The firsts posts have more basic questions already answered.
Many of those things are yet done /asked/replied.
Search for "eye blink" in the search area. And you'll see lots of files there.
